[02/10] brcmfmac: remove obsolete sdio bus sleep mechanism

From: Franky Lin <frankyl@broadcom.com>

Remove sdio bus sleep mechanism since it is never invoked.

-static int brcmf_sdbrcm_bussleep(struct brcmf_sdio *bus, bool sleep)
-{
-	int ret;
-
-	brcmf_dbg(INFO, "request %s (currently %s)\n",
-		  sleep ? "SLEEP" : "WAKE",
-		  bus->sleeping ? "SLEEP" : "WAKE");
-
-	/* Done if we're already in the requested state */
-	if (sleep == bus->sleeping)
-		return 0;
-
-	/* Going to sleep: set the alarm and turn off the lights... */
-	if (sleep) {
-		/* Don't sleep if something is pending */
-		if (bus->dpc_sched || bus->rxskip || pktq_len(&bus->txq))
-			return -EBUSY;
-
-		/* Make sure the controller has the bus up */
-		brcmf_sdbrcm_clkctl(bus, CLK_AVAIL, false);
-
-		/* Tell device to start using OOB wakeup */
-		ret = w_sdreg32(bus, SMB_USE_OOB,
-				offsetof(struct sdpcmd_regs, tosbmailbox));
-		if (ret != 0)
-			brcmf_dbg(ERROR, "CANNOT SIGNAL CHIP, WILL NOT WAKE UP!!\n");
-
-		/* Turn off our contribution to the HT clock request */
-		brcmf_sdbrcm_clkctl(bus, CLK_SDONLY, false);
-
-		brcmf_sdio_regwb(bus->sdiodev, SBSDIO_FUNC1_CHIPCLKCSR,
-				 SBSDIO_FORCE_HW_CLKREQ_OFF, NULL);
-
-		/* Isolate the bus */
-		brcmf_sdio_regwb(bus->sdiodev, SBSDIO_DEVICE_CTL,
-				 SBSDIO_DEVCTL_PADS_ISO, NULL);
-
-		/* Change state */
-		bus->sleeping = true;
-
-	} else {
-		/* Waking up: bus power up is ok, set local state */
-
-		brcmf_sdio_regwb(bus->sdiodev, SBSDIO_FUNC1_CHIPCLKCSR,
-				 0, NULL);
-
-		/* Make sure the controller has the bus up */
-		brcmf_sdbrcm_clkctl(bus, CLK_AVAIL, false);
-
-		/* Send misc interrupt to indicate OOB not needed */
-		ret = w_sdreg32(bus, 0,
-				offsetof(struct sdpcmd_regs, tosbmailboxdata));
-		if (ret == 0)
-			ret = w_sdreg32(bus, SMB_DEV_INT,
-				offsetof(struct sdpcmd_regs, tosbmailbox));
-
-		if (ret != 0)
-			brcmf_dbg(ERROR, "CANNOT SIGNAL CHIP TO CLEAR OOB!!\n");
-
-		/* Make sure we have SD bus access */
-		brcmf_sdbrcm_clkctl(bus, CLK_SDONLY, false);
-
-		/* Change state */
-		bus->sleeping = false;
-	}
-
-	return 0;
-}
